Are skateboard shock pads essential for downhill skating?

The use of skateboard shock pads in downhill skating has been a topic of debate among enthusiasts and professionals alike. While some riders swear by the benefits of incorporating shock pads into their setup, others remain skeptical about their necessity.In reality, the importance of skateboard shock pads for downhill skating depends on several factors, including the type of riding you do, the terrain you're facing, and your personal preference for feedback from your board. Downhill skating involves high speeds and intense impacts, which can put a lot of stress on both the rider's body and the skateboard itself.If you're an experienced downhill skater who is comfortable with the feel and response of their board, you might not find shock pads essential. However, if you're just starting out or want to upgrade your riding experience, incorporating shock pads could provide several benefits:* Reduced impact absorption: Shock pads can help absorb some of the intense impacts associated with high-speed downhill skating, making it more comfortable for your body.* Enhanced control: By providing a softer and more forgiving ride, shock pads can give you more control over your board at high speeds.* Extended skateboard lifespan: The added cushioning provided by shock pads can help reduce wear and tear on your skateboard's trucks and wheels.Some popular types of skateboarding shock pads include:* Standard shock pads: These are the most common type and provide a medium level of impact absorption and control enhancement.* High-density shock pads: These offer more advanced features, such as improved durability and increased resistance to abrasion.* Customizable shock pads: Some manufacturers allow you to tailor the feel and response of their shock pads to your specific riding style.Ultimately, whether skateboard shock pads are essential for downhill skating depends on your individual needs and preferences. If you're interested in trying out a pair or upgrading your existing setup, be sure to research the different types and options available.

What are the benefits of using skateboard shock pads on rough terrain?

Using skateboard shock pads on rough terrain can provide several benefits for skaters. Firstly, these pads absorb and distribute the impact of landing jumps and navigating uneven surfaces, reducing the stress on a skater's knees, ankles, and other joints. This is particularly important for skaters who regularly perform high-impact tricks or ride in areas with a lot of rocks, bumps, and potholes.By cushioning the impact of rough terrain, skateboard shock pads can also help to prevent injuries such as bruising, sprains, and strains. Additionally, they can improve a skater's overall comfort and confidence while riding, allowing them to focus on their skills and performance rather than worrying about the discomfort or pain caused by the terrain. By investing in high-quality skateboard shock pads, skaters can enjoy a smoother ride and reduce their risk of injury.

Which type of skateboard shock pad is best suited for beginners?

For beginners, we recommend starting with a skateboard shock pad that provides a smooth and stable ride. A polyurethane (PU) based shock pad is an excellent choice for its durability and consistent performance. These pads are designed to absorb impact and provide a comfortable ride, making it easier for new riders to balance and learn tricks.When choosing a PU-based shock pad, consider the density of the material, which will affect the level of cushioning provided. A higher-density pad may offer more support but can also make the skateboard feel stiffer. Conversely, a lower-density pad will provide more cushioning but may not be as supportive. Look for pads with a mid-range density that strikes a balance between comfort and stability.
